Title: Bifold Door Hinge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Bifold doors are a popular option for homeowners who wish to save area and include a touch of beauty to their homes. These doors consist of 2 panels that fold against each other, enabling them to slide open and closed smoothly. Nevertheless, like any other door, bifold doors can experience wear and tear, particularly on their hinges. This short article will offer an extensive guide to bifold door hinge repair, consisting of the tools you'll need, the steps to follow, and some regularly asked questions.

Tools You'll Need:
- Screwdriver
- Hammer
- Chisel
- Wood filler
- Sandpaper
- Paint or stain (optional)
- Replacement hinges
Steps to Follow:
Identify the Problem: The primary step in bifold door hinge repair is to determine the issue. Inspect if the door is sagging, tough to open or close, or if there are any visible signs of damage on the hinges.
Remove the Door: To repair the hinges, you'll need to eliminate the door from the frame. Start by eliminating the screws that hold the hinges to the door frame. Then, carefully lift the door off the hinges and place it on a flat surface.
Examine the Hinges: Once the door is removed, check the hinges for any signs of damage. Try to find loose screws, bent or damaged hinge leaves, or any other visible damage.
Repair or Replace the Hinges: If the hinges are repairable, tighten up any loose screws and hammer any bent hinge leaves back into place. If the hinges are beyond repair, eliminate them from the door and frame and replace them with brand-new ones.
Fill Any Holes: If you've removed the old hinges, you'll likely be entrusted holes in the door and frame. Fill these holes with wood filler, permit it to dry, and after that sand it down till it's smooth.
Reattach the Door: Once the wood filler is dry and sanded, reattach the door to the frame using the new hinges. Make certain the door is level and aligned effectively before tightening up the screws.
FAQs:
- Can I repair a bifold door hinge myself, or do I need to hire an expert?
While it is possible to repair a bifold door hinge yourself, it may be easier to employ an expert if you're not comfortable dealing with tools or if the damage is comprehensive.
- How often do bifold door hinges requirement to be replaced?
Bifold door hinges can last for several years with correct upkeep. Nevertheless, they may need to be replaced every 5-10 years, depending upon use and wear and tear.
- Can I use any type of hinge for my bifold door maintaining Tips door?
No, it's essential to utilize hinges particularly created for bifold doors. These hinges are made to accommodate the folding motion of the door and will ensure smooth operation.
- How do I understand if my bifold door hinges are beyond repair?
If the hinges are badly bent, rusted, or have actually broken leaves, they may be beyond repair and need to be replaced.
- Can I paint or stain my bifold door after fixing the hinges?
Yes, as soon as the wood filler is dry and sanded, you can paint or stain your bifold door to match the rest of your design.
